A popular POD printer in the USA called LIghtning Source wants the 
finished page to be centered on an 8.5 x 11 sheet of paper in the pdf 
file submitted to them. This can be done with \definepapersze and 
\setuppapersize. However this technique shows cropmarks and 
Lighting Source specifies "no crop marks."

Question 1: How do I eliminate cropmarks yet still have the smaller page 
centered on the larger page? 

Second, my customer pointed out to me that on my finished pdf the
cropmarks do not exactly delineate the specific size (in this case 5.5 x 
8.5 inches.)   On my laser printer they define a space about 1/32 inch 
shorter than the nominal dimension in both vertical and horizontal 
directions. This is about 2 or 3 points. 

Question 2. Why are the cropmarks apparently imprecise?

From: Erik George Hetzner @ 2003-09-10 23:33 UTC (permalink / raw)


John Culleton writes: [cropped to save space]
 > Question 1: How do I eliminate cropmarks yet still have the smaller page 
 > centered on the larger page? 
 > Question 2. Why are the cropmarks apparently imprecise?

First question: \setuplayout[marking=no] or is it marking=off? One of
the two.

Second question: I have no idea. One possible thing which has arisen for
me many times: assuming you are printing from Acrobat, are your
print settings set to either enlarge or shrink pages? This is
something I know I have gotten wrong more than once.

From: Patrick Gundlach @ 2003-09-11  8:48 UTC (permalink / raw)



> Question 1: How do I eliminate cropmarks yet still have the smaller page 
> centered on the larger page? 

\setuplayout[marking=on,location=middle]

> Question 2. Why are the cropmarks apparently imprecise?

Don't know, this is a good question. It is not very much, but it is
strange indeed.

Correct. sometmes I forget what I did :-(
 > Second question: I have no idea. 
I ran tests with Context pdftex and plain TeX using a 6 inch horizontal 
rule and no other typography. They all came up about 3/64 inch short. 
In the plain TeX sample I used dvips and printed from the PS file.
So it appears my printer shrinks a file by about 1% or thereabouts.  My 
customer's printer must do the same. It is not a Context problem nor an 
Acrobat Reader problem.
